Medford, OR
Local storm history & FEMA National Risk Index data
Medford is rated Relatively Moderate for overall natural hazard risk — near the middle compared to other US counties — based on FEMA's National Risk Index for Jackson County, OR. The county's highest-rated hazards are wildfire, earthquake, and winter weather.

County-wide hazard risk
Every other hazard FEMA and NOAA track — including drought — is only scored at the county level. These are Jackson County's FEMA National Risk Index scores, covering Medford along with the rest of the county, not a Medford-specific figure.
| Hazard | NRI score | Rating |
|---|---|---|
| Wildfire | 99 | Relatively High |
| Inland Flooding | 93.1 | Relatively Moderate |
| Coastal Flooding | — | Not Applicable |
| Earthquake | 97.4 | Relatively Moderate |
| Heat Wave | 94.9 | Relatively Moderate |
| Tornado | 6.5 | Very Low |
| Avalanche | 32.5 | Very Low |
| Cold Wave | 8.7 | Very Low |
| Drought | 17 | Very Low |
| Hail | 43.4 | Relatively Low |
| Hurricane | — | Not Applicable |
| Ice Storm | 19.2 | Very Low |
| Landslide | 86.5 | Relatively Low |
| Lightning | 60.4 | Relatively Moderate |
| Strong Wind | 27.9 | Relatively Low |
| Tsunami | — | Not Applicable |
| Volcanic Activity | 77.5 | Very Low |
| Winter Weather | 96.7 | Very High |
Source: FEMA National Risk Index v1.20.0, December 2025. See the methodology page for definitions, or the full Jackson County risk profile for disaster declarations, social vulnerability, and climate projection data.
